Biographical history

Clive Robert Moore was born in 1951 in Mackay. He received his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in 1973 and his PhD in 1981 from James Cook University. From the 1970s, his research interests have included the history of Queensland, Australia, Pacific Islands, New Guinea, Papua New Guinea, Vanuatu and Solomon Islands; community, ethnic and minority history; and public and organisational history. In 2005, he was awarded a Cross of Solomon Islands for his historical work on Malaita Island. Moore is an Emeritus Professor at The University of Queensland. From 2008 to 2013 he was Head of the School of History, Philosophy, Religion and Classics. He retired from the McCaughey Chair in History in 2015. Moore has authored numerous books, chapters, journal articles and reports on the Solomon Islands, New Guinea, Australia’s Pacific Island immigrants, federation, masculinity and sexuality.

Scope and content

Correspondence, publications, compact discs, research papers and conference papers, book reviews relating to Clive Moore’s work on Indigenous Australians, Pacific Islanders and the Queensland sugar factory history.
